Thanks Michael, The problem is now fixed. It was the permissions of the /dev/sgX (/dev/sg0 on my system), as you suggested. I changed that and grip works fine. For the record, ls -l /dev/sg0 said crw------- 1 root adm 21, 0 2005-02-26 08:38 /dev/sg0 and I after I did chmod g+rw /dev/sg0 ls -l /dev/sg0 said crw-rw---- 1 root adm 21, 0 2005-02-26 08:38 /dev/sg0 Thanks again for the help.
